Virginia Business Legal Elite

Eight Reed Smith attorneys have been named to the Virginia Business – Legal Elite. The eight include five from the firm's Tysons office: Benton Burroughs, Jr., Michael S. Dingman, Brent R. Gary, Grayson P. Hanes, and Mark W. Wasserman; and three from Richmond: Betty S.W. Graumlich, Edward A. Mullen, and Jeffrey S. Palmore.

The Legal Elite began in 2000 as a collaboration with the Virginia Bar Association. Virginia Business annually polls more than 14,000 attorneys in the commonwealth, asking them to select from among their peers the best lawyers in each practice category. Since its beginning, the number of categories has grown from 10 to 18, and results involve practices that are based not only on reaction to public policy, but also on efforts to shape it.
